Book about Latvian, Baltic, Nordic films now available
The Riga International Film Festival spokesman Kaspars Bekeris told LETA that the book offered information about the most important film directors and producers in the region, about Baltic and Nordic' films screened abroad, and the key film festivals in the Baltic countries.
The book, written by Jan Erik Holst, focuses on Baltic-Nordic co-productions, but it also tells about filmmaking in Latvia since the restoration of independence.
"I can assure you that Jan Erik Holst has conducted singular research with symbolic importance. Besides film projects, the author in essence describes the development of Latvia and Latvian arts since the restoration of independence," says Riga International Film Festival Artistic Director Sonora Broka.
The book has also generated a good deal of publicity in the author's native Norway, earning accolades from the country's leading film critics.
